Originally a kolkhoz was a form of collective farm in the Soviet Union. Nowadays this word is used by Russian people to describe poorly executed DIY project. Such projects usually aim to get the job done by simplest and cheapest way, disregarding aesthetics, reliability and safety.
John: Did you fix that device you was talking about?
Alexander: Yes. It such kolkhoz for now, but it is working. I will redo this properly after I get suitable parts.

A derogatory term used to describe a person with poor taste, lack of culture, or rural manners. Similar to calling someone a tacky, uneducated villager. Often implies someone who is loud, unfashionable, and unaware of modern social norms.
Origin: Comes from the Russian word kolkhoz (collective farm during the Soviet era). Originally tied to stereotypes of unsophisticated peasants from collective farms, it later evolved into a general insult for someone seen as uncultured or tasteless.
